Singapore-based designer Eden Loh has developed a method to repurpose discarded eggshells sourced from a local carrot cake hawker stall, Carrot Cubes, into functional homeware. By collecting the waste material, Loh transforms the eggshells into a composite substance used to manufacture items such as planters, plates, and egg trays.
The initiative highlights creative approaches to local waste management and circular design within Singapore's food and hawker culture sectors, giving single-use kitchen refuse a second life as durable consumer goods.
